Secular Morality from "The Science of Good and Evil" by Michael Shermer

The Ask First Principle:
- Is an action right or wrong? Ask first.

The Happiness Principle:
- It is a higher moral principle to always seek happiness with someone else's happiness in mind.
- Never seek happiness when it leads to someone else's unhappiness
- Follow the win-win principle
- Always seek gain through the gain of others, never seek gain through the forced or fraudulent loss of others.

The Liberty Principle:
- It is a higher moral principle to always seek liberty with someone else's liberty in mind.
- Never seek happiness when it leads to someone else's loss of liberty

The Moderation Principle:
When innocent people die, extremism in the defense of anything is no virtue, and moderation in the protection of everything is no vice.
